Mastercard is undergoing a "mobile transformation" and is looking at opportunities in the wider mobile sector including connected cars, wearables and the Internet of Things (IoT).

Revealing the news at the Mobile Marketing Association (MMA) London Forum yesterday, for which The Drum was media partner, Marc Michel, vice president/ business leader digital marketing Europe Mastercard, spoke about the disruption in the payment industry and the opportunities for the financial services brand.

"The payment industry is ripe for disruption and change," he said. "Mastercard is undergoing a mobile transformation; when we start thinking about Mastercard as an organisation we think about mobility and not just the mobile device - whether it be wearbales, your car as a mobile device or IoT - there's going to be a lot of changes in how we are constantly connected and how we are using screens. So I think that is going to be an exciting opportunity. At mastercard we have a world of opportunity."

Michel added that Mastercard "could do more" with SMS messaging but warned of the method's "creepy factor" which consumers can see as intrusive.
